Abstract
Paraphytoseius scleroticus (Gupta & Ray, 1981) known only from the holotype female
and having some unique morphological features, was examined and photographed in the
Zoological Survey of India, Kolkata, India. Voucher photos included in the present
study indicate the presence of setae z2 and z4 on the dorsal shield that are serrated and
much longer than in any other known species of the genus Paraphytoseius. Seta S5,
unique for representing the cracentis species group Chant & McMurtry, 2003, to which
P. scleroticus belongs, is clearly evident lateral to seta Z5. Lyrifissure idm5, not
discussed or illustrated by Gupta & Ray (1981), is also present posteromedial to base of
seta S5. As type specimens of many mites deteriorate over the years and often no longer
show important morphological features, or are not available for study by acarologists, or
are lost due to various reasons, taking voucher photos of the important features of type
specimens, especially of soft bodied mites, is strongly suggested. These may be placed
online for use by the phytoseiid taxonomists. A new genus, Paraphytoevanseius Prasad
gen. nov., is described and a key for the identification of different genera of the subtribe
Paraphytoseiina, including the new genus, and Paraphytoevanseius arjunae (Sadanan-dan, 2006) comb. nov. are given.
